Exploring the Power of Java: A Comprehensive Guide

Java is one of the most popular programming languages in the world, known for its versatility and portability. In this blog post, we will explore the key features of Java, its applications, and best practices for developers.

Why Choose Java?

Java offers several advantages that make it a preferred choice for developers:

  • Platform Independence: Write once, run anywhere (WORA) capability.
  • Object-Oriented: Encourages modular programming and code reusability.
  • Strong Community Support: Extensive libraries and frameworks available.
  • Robust Performance: Optimized for performance and security.

Key Features of Java

Java is packed with features that enhance its capabilities:

  • Automatic Memory Management: Java uses garbage collection to manage memory.
  • Multithreading: Enables concurrent execution of two or more threads.
  • Rich Standard Library: Provides a comprehensive API for various tasks.
  • Security: Built-in security features to protect against threats.

Popular Java Frameworks and Libraries

Java's ecosystem includes many frameworks and libraries that simplify development:

  • Spring: A powerful framework for building enterprise applications.
  • Hibernate: An ORM framework for database interactions.
  • JavaFX: For building rich desktop applications.
  • Apache Maven: A project management tool for Java projects.

Getting Started with Java

To start coding in Java, follow these steps:

  1. Install the Java Development Kit (JDK).
  2. Set up an Integrated Development Environment (IDE) like IntelliJ IDEA or Eclipse.
  3. Create a simple Java program:
public class HelloWorld {
    public static void main(String[] args) {
        System.out.println("Hello, World!");
    }
}

Best Practices for Java Development

Adhering to best practices can enhance your Java development experience:

  • Follow Naming Conventions: Use clear and consistent naming for classes and methods.
  • Code Documentation: Document your code effectively using Javadoc.
  • Unit Testing: Implement unit tests to ensure code reliability.
  • Version Control: Use Git for source code management.

Real-World Applications of Java

Java is widely used across various domains:

  • Web Development: Building dynamic websites and applications.
  • Mobile Development: Developing Android applications.
  • Enterprise Applications: Used by large organizations for business solutions.
  • Big Data Technologies: Frameworks like Apache Hadoop are built on Java.
